在现代操作系统中,Linux 是一种广泛使用的开源操作系统,以其稳定性和灵活性受到开发者和系统管理员的青睐。进入 Linux 系统的家目录(Home Directory)是用户日常使用中最基本的操作之一,它不仅关系到用户的个性化配置,也直接影响到文件管理、环境变量设置以及程序运行的便捷性。在 Linux 系统中,家目录通常位于 `/home/用户名`,其中 `用户名` 是当前登录的用户。对于初学者或经验丰富的用户,了解如何进入家目录是掌握 Linux 系统操作的第一步。本文将详细介绍 Linux 系统中如何进入家目录,涵盖多种方法,包括命令行操作、GUI 工具以及系统配置等,帮助用户全面掌握这一核心技能。 一、进入家目录的基本概念 在 Linux 系统中,每个用户都有一个独立的家目录,用于存储个人文件、配置文件、应用程序等。家目录的路径通常为 `/home/用户名`,其中 `用户名` 是当前登录的用户。进入家目录的目的是为了访问和管理个人文件,设置环境变量,配置用户权限等。进入家目录的方法多种多样,本文将从命令行、图形界面、系统配置等多个角度进行详细说明。 二、命令行操作进入家目录 1.使用 `cd` 命令切换目录 `cd` 是 Linux 系统中最常用的目录切换命令。用户可以通过 `cd` 命令切换到家目录。具体操作如下: - 命令格式:`cd /home/用户名` 其中 `用户名` 是当前登录的用户。 - 示例: ```bash $ cd /home/username ``` - 说明: 如果用户已经登录到系统,可以直接使用 `cd` 命令切换到家目录。如果用户尚未登录,可以通过 `su` 或 `sudo` 命令切换到其他用户,然后再切换到家目录。 2.使用 `login` 命令进入家目录 在 Linux 系统中,用户登录时,系统会自动将用户切换到其家目录。
也是因为这些,用户无需手动切换目录,只需登录即可。 - 示例: ```bash $ ssh user@hostname ``` 登录后,系统会自动将用户切换到家目录,用户可以直接在该目录下进行操作。 3.使用 `ls` 命令查看家目录内容 在进入家目录后,用户可以通过 `ls` 命令查看目录中的文件和子目录。 - 示例: ```bash $ ls ``` 该命令会列出家目录下的所有文件和子目录,方便用户快速查找所需内容。 三、图形界面操作进入家目录 在图形界面环境中,用户可以通过图形工具进入家目录,适合不熟悉命令行操作的用户。 1.使用文件管理器进入家目录 Linux 系统中的文件管理器(如 Nautilus、Thunar 等)提供了直观的界面,用户可以通过以下步骤进入家目录: - 步骤 1:打开文件管理器(如 Nautilus)。 - 步骤 2:在文件管理器中,点击“文件”菜单,选择“前往”。 - 步骤 3:输入 `/home/用户名`,按回车键进入家目录。 2.使用终端模拟器进入家目录 对于不熟悉图形界面的用户,可以使用终端模拟器(如 GNOME Terminal、Konsole 等)进入家目录。 - 步骤 1:打开终端模拟器。 - 步骤 2:输入 `cd /home/用户名`,按回车键。 - 步骤 3:确认是否进入家目录。 四、系统配置与权限管理 进入家目录不仅仅是切换目录,还涉及系统配置和权限管理。用户在进入家目录后,需要设置环境变量、配置用户权限等。 1.设置环境变量 在 Linux 系统中,环境变量通常位于 `/etc/environment` 文件中。用户可以通过编辑该文件来设置环境变量,例如: - 示例: ```bash $ nano /etc/environment ``` 在文件中添加以下内容: ``` HOME=/home/username PATH=/usr/local/bin:/usr/bin:/bin ``` - 说明: 保存文件后,系统会自动加载这些环境变量,确保用户在进入家目录后能够正常运行程序。 2.配置用户权限 用户在进入家目录后,需要确保其权限设置正确,以避免文件访问权限问题。 - 步骤 1:检查家目录的权限: ```bash $ ls -l /home/username ``` - 步骤 2:如果权限不正确,可以使用 `chmod` 命令修改权限: ```bash $ chmod 700 /home/username ``` - 说明: `700` 表示所有者有完全权限,其他用户无权限,适用于需要严格权限控制的目录。 五、其他方法进入家目录 1.使用 `su` 或 `sudo` 切换用户 如果用户需要切换到其他用户,可以使用 `su` 或 `sudo` 命令。 - 使用 `su` 命令: ```bash $ su username ``` - 使用 `sudo` 命令: ```bash $ sudo su username ``` - 说明: 通过 `su` 或 `sudo` 命令切换到其他用户后,系统会自动将用户切换到其家目录。 2.使用 `login` 命令 在某些系统中,用户可以通过 `login` 命令手动切换到家目录。 - 示例: ```bash $ login username ``` - 说明: 该命令会提示用户输入密码,登录后系统会自动将用户切换到家目录。 六、常见问题与解决方法 1.无法进入家目录 - 可能原因: - 用户未登录,需要先登录系统。 - 家目录路径错误,如 `/home/username` 不正确。 - 权限不足,无法访问家目录。 - 解决方法: - 登录系统,使用 `cd` 命令切换到家目录。 - 检查家目录路径是否正确。 - 使用 `chmod` 命令修改权限。 2.家目录内容不显示 - 可能原因: - 文件管理器未正确加载家目录。 - 系统配置错误。 - 解决方法: - 重启文件管理器或系统。 - 检查系统配置文件,确保家目录路径正确。 七、归结起来说 进入 Linux 系统的家目录是日常操作中不可或缺的一部分,无论是通过命令行、图形界面还是系统配置,用户都可以找到合适的方法。无论你是新手还是经验丰富的用户,掌握进入家目录的方法,都能大大提高工作效率。在实际操作中,用户需要注意权限设置、环境变量配置以及系统权限管理,以确保家目录的安全性和功能性。通过本文的详细讲解,用户可以全面了解如何进入家目录,并在实际工作中灵活运用这些方法。